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Charlotte Central School (Charlotte, VT)
Charlotte Central School is situated in the heart of Charlotte, Vermont, a picturesque town nestled between the Adirondack Mountains to the west and Lake Champlain to the east. The school is centrally located on Hinesburg Road, offering convenient access to the surrounding rural landscape and nearby amenities. The primary access route is VT Route 7, which connects Charlotte to Burlington to the north and Middlebury to the south, providing a gateway to larger towns and cities. Parking is available directly at the school, though it can become congested during major events, making early arrival advisable. The nearest major airport is Burlington International Airport (BTV), approximately a 25-minute drive north. While public transportation options directly serving the school are limited, local taxi services and rideshares are available from Burlington and surrounding towns. Driving is the most common mode of transport, and understanding the local road network, particularly VT Route 7 and smaller connecting roads, is key to a smooth arrival. Consider exiting VT Route 7 onto Hinesburg Road well in advance of peak times to avoid potential traffic.
Lodging contextWhere to Stay Near Charlotte Central School
The immediate vicinity of Charlotte Central School is characterized by a blend of residential areas, farms, and small village centers, rather than dense hotel clusters. Most accommodations will be found a short drive away, particularly in the town of Shelburne to the north or the city of Burlington further north. These areas offer a range of hotel options, from budget-friendly motels to more upscale inns. While many visitors may choose to stay in Burlington for its wider selection of hotels and amenities, Shelburne offers closer proximity. For those attending events at the school, booking lodging in advance is highly recommended, especially during the school year when local events and sports seasons can increase demand. Utilizing map filters for hotels within a 15-20 minute driving radius of Charlotte will be most effective. Consider the trade-off between the convenience of staying in Burlington and the slightly longer, but often scenic, drive to Charlotte.

Shelburne Museum
The Shelburne Museum is a nationally renowned museum of American folk art, with a diverse collection housed in 38 buildings spread across 45 acres. It offers an immersive experience, showcasing everything from antique carousel horses to Impressionist paintings and maritime artifacts. Plan for several hours to explore its unique exhibits, many of which are historic structures brought to the site. It's an ideal destination for a rainy day or to enrich your cultural understanding of the region.

Weather & Seasons at Charlotte Central School
- Winter: Winter in Charlotte typically brings cold temperatures, with daytime highs often in the low 20s to 30s Fahrenheit. Snowfall is common, blanketing the landscape and creating picturesque scenes. Visitors should pack warm layers, including heavy coats, hats, gloves, and waterproof boots. Driving can be impacted by snow and ice, so allow extra travel time and ensure your vehicle is prepared for winter conditions.
- Spring & early summer: Spring and early summer offer a refreshing transition with temperatures gradually warming from the 40s to the 60s and 70s Fahrenheit. Expect variable weather, including rain showers, as the landscape greens. Pack light to medium layers, a waterproof jacket, and comfortable walking shoes. Outdoor activities become more enjoyable, but it’s wise to be prepared for cooler evenings or unexpected rainfall.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er typically sees temperatures ranging from the 70s to the 80s Fahrenheit, with occasional heatwaves pushing into the 90s. Humidity can be noticeable, especially near Lake Champlain. Lightweight clothing, t-shirts, shorts, and sun protection (hats, sunscreen) are essential. While generally pleasant for outdoor events, be prepared for warm conditions and stay hydrated.
- Fall season: Fall brings crisp air and vibrant foliage, with temperatures cooling from the 60s down into the 40s Fahrenheit. Evenings can become quite cool. Layers are key, including sweaters, light jackets, and perhaps a warmer coat as the season progresses. Comfortable walking shoes are a must for enjoying the autumn scenery. Be prepared for brisk mornings and evenings.
- Rain & snow: Rain is possible in any season, often occurring as spring showers or summer thunderstorms. Winter brings snow, which can range from light dustings to significant accumulations. Always pack a reliable umbrella or rain jacket and waterproof footwear. For snowy conditions, heavy-duty boots and warm, water-resistant outerwear are crucial for comfort and safety when navigating outdoor spaces.
